The Power in Seeking ‘Expert Advice’

The junkman took millions of dollars in ore from the mine because he knew enough to seek expert counsel before giving up.

That quote comes form the #1 personal development best seller, Think and Grow Rich (Napoleon Hill), written 100 years ago.

Hill spent 20 years interviewing repeatedly 500 of our most successful citizens to see what was it was THEY were doing that the rest of us were not. The story was about gold mining and hitting the ‘wall’ — the gold stopped.

The mine owner sold all his equipment to the local junkman, who KNEW enough to find a geologist — an Expert. And he learned he was only 3 feet from gold! When seeking expert advice it is important to  NOT give away the whole plan or goal! Only say what you need … “why has the gold dried up?” Saying how much money is invested, how big the plot is, what you will do with the money, etc. is NOT to be shared. WHYthat is so is another blog.

I DID IT! I teach it and I know it … and 2 days ago, I DID IT!

After receiving an offer by mail to do a mortgage refinance on my home, I called. All was proceeding well via phone … looked like I’d have a windfall, pay less each month … all was wonderful. THEN … the rep said “you’ll need $ 845 up front to lock in this deal.”

MY HACKLES WENT UP!

I’ve closed on properties and done refinancing all my life and NO ONE EVER demanded cash up front. I said, “I will need 24 hours as I will have a mortgage expert review the details on my behalf.”And I did that.

While my Expert also found it unusual for money to be demanded u p front, the due diligence revealed it wasa GOOD deal.

The expert called the rep to ask a couple of questions on my behalf, one about the money up front. The rep said that it was a misunderstanding and that the cash comes out at closing. Of course it does!

As a result of insisting I pay cash up front and telling my expert quite the opposite, I have chosen to NOT do business with this company.

The deal was good! Yes! Yet the expert review made all the difference.

I don’t do business with people who appear to be “loving money, and using people,” rather than “loving people, and using money” as a tool.

Always seek expert advice. You can’t know everything. Andrew Carnegie (who hired Hill to write Think and Grow Rich) had no less than 60 experts in different fields on staff at all times! I’ve got one here, and one there. I’m using them … as they use me!

Stefan Duncan is the creator of ‘squiggleism’- a branch of impressionism and dubbed the “American Van Gogh” by  vangoghgallery.com. He was recently recognized as one of the top ‘Thirty Plein Air’ Artists of America by the Wekiva Island Paint Out, an invitation only with Florida’s state parks,  and among one of ‘America’s Best Artist’ by Art Business News magazine.   “Grandfather’s Dream”, a book illustrated by Stefan was recently released online: http://www.grandfathersdream.com/

Stefan, a native of North Carolina,  is a part time writer and full time artist creating murals, commission paintings, landscapes, book illustrations, and inspirational series of exhibits several times a year. He contributes his time and paintings to many charitable organizations throughout the year. Stefan has both an English and Art degree and teaches art classes in the Charlotte and Huntersville areas.

The Power of your Virtual Assistant Profile

The job of a Virtual Assistant is to serve the needs of clients “virtually” online. That often means that a Virtual Assistant’s online profiles will be reviewed BEFORE any connection to that VA will be made by the potential client.




Here are a few tips to ensure that your Virtual Assistant profile truthfully represents who you are:



1. Skill Level – Be sure to note the various skills that you offer your clients. They will want to know what problems you can solve for them.



2. Recommendations – When you do an amazing job for clients, be sure to ask for a written recommendation (i.e. LinkedIn). This is a powerful way for others to see how you related with a previous client.



3. Honesty – Be honest about your previous work experience, connections and business relationships. In today’s online arena, false information can EASILY be found out.



4.Thankful – Take the time to thank someone who does give you a recommendation. That was an effort of their time and commitment on your behalf.

Power of the Pause

A few weeks ago I attended a Quaker’s meeting which is, in part, a long period of quiet interrupted intermittently by those who may wish to speak. I was impressed with the power of that experience – a long pause in a busy, noisy world. Even though I was a newcomer I was moved to speak about a new appreciation of “the pause”.

In my acupuncture/physical therapy practice I do a type of body work called Zero Balancing (ZB). An actual component of the ZB protocol is the pause . The pause lasts anywhere from 5 seconds to a minute or even longer. It provides an opportunity for the client to integrate changes introduced by the practitioner before moving on to the next phase of the protocol. The practitioner looks for specific signs from the client that say “I’ve got it”. It is one of the most powerful aspects of the treatment.

Where else in our lives might the pause appear? How about in listening? I am committed to taking more time to listen to my clients, friends and acquaintances. I want to pause to really hear what they are saying – instead of using the opening to jump in with my own words. The pause can show respect for the other person’s words or thoughts before introducing those of my own.

We can also pause in our speaking to give the listener time to hear or reflect on one thought before adding another. The pause gives emphasis. It can provide an opportunity for the listener to seek clarification or participate in a conversation about the thought.

The most important pause of all can be the pause in our lives as at the Friends Meeting, in meditation, taking a vacation or even time for lunch. As is often said about music, it’s not the notes alone that make the music but the pause between them. Is there music in your life?
